Final Shots: Gary Grant Wehlage

Gary Grant Wehlage passed away on March 29, having lived a full and meaningful life rooted in family, the outdoors, and a deep appreciation for the simple things. Gary was a respected professor at the University of Wisconsin – Madison, where he devoted his career to teaching, mentorship, and a genuine care for students. As part of the School of Education, he focused his work on helping all students succeed, especially those at risk of being left behind. Through both his teaching and his work, Gary made a lasting impact on students, educators, and the field of education. Upon his retirement, he was honored with emeritus status, a reflection of his distinguished service and lasting contributions.

Gary developed a deep passion for skeet shooting after joining Middleton Sportsmen’s club in the 1970s, going on to build an accomplished competitive career. He earned multiple All-State and All-American honors, along with several major titles, including state championships. Following his retirement, he devoted more time to the sport and achieved some of his greatest successes. Gary also gave back to the skeet shooting community through leadership roles with the Sauk Prairie Gun Club and the Wisconsin Skeet Shooting Association, leaving a lasting impact on the sport he loved.

Gary was diagnosed with Parkinson’s disease in 2014, a challenge he faced with remarkable courage and resilience. His lifelong commitment to staying active helped sustain both his physical and mental strength for many years. His determination and quiet strength were an inspiration to all who knew him.

Gary is survived by his wife of over 65 years, Nancy; two children, four grandchildren, and a great-granddaughter. He will be remembered for his love of the outdoors, his devotion to family, his many talents, and the life he built with Nancy.

The family requests that any memorial contributions be made to the National Skeet Shooting Association in honor of Gary’s lifelong passion for skeet shooting.

The NSSA community will miss Gary, and we extend our deepest sympathies to his family and many friends.
